The winning entry for the Multiple District 1997-98 Lions Peace Poster Contest was sponsored by the Marshfield Lions Club in District 26-H. Eleven year old Casey Cantrell was the artist. She is in the 6th grade at Webster Elementary School in Marshfield. Her winning entry, a good depiction of the contest theme A World in Harmony, was sent to International to be entered in the International Contest.The grand prize winning poster was chosen, February 9 at the Chicago Children's Museum in Chicago Illinois. While not the grand prize winner, Casey's poster was selected as one of the 23 merit award winners. Her poster along with the other 22 merit award winners and the grand prize winner will be on display in a traveling
